Fund Manager:
SBB Mutual Bhd. (formerly known as BHLB Pacific Trust)

Fund Name:
SBB Dana Al-Mizan (balanced, formerly known as BHLB Pacific Dana Al-Mizan)

Launch Date:
Mar-01

Screening (except economy):
Islamic Syariah fund

KEY Characteristics:
This is an Islamic growth and income fund that allows you to achieve medium to long term growth in both capital and income by investing in permissible Syariah investments. The strategy of the fund will be to invest up to a maximum of 60% in equities and the remaining in fixed income securities and liquid assets.

This fund is suitable for investors who look for a balance of capital appreciation and regular distributions, have long term goals of retirement or financing a child’s college education, and expect to receive distributions on a regular basis on condition that the realized income is attained.

Being a balanced fund, Dana al-Mizan provides Syariah-adherent Muslim investors, as well as all other investors, with a different type of Islamic fund to invest in as most of the existing Islamic funds in Malaysia belong to the growth category.
